Understanding Your Target Audience
Knowing your audience is the cornerstone of any marketing plan. For tow truck services, this means identifying who your customers are—be it stranded motorists, businesses needing roadside assistance, or individuals requiring specialized towing services. Understanding demographics, needs, and pain points allows you to tailor your marketing messages effectively.
For instance, if you cater to commercial clients, your marketing should emphasize reliability and speed. On the other hand, targeting individual consumers might mean showcasing your prompt service and competitive pricing. Use surveys, feedback, and local market research to gather insights that inform your strategy.
Identifying your audience sets the stage for the next steps in your marketing plan. By understanding who you’re targeting, you can create tailored campaigns that resonate and engage effectively.

Leveraging Local SEO for Visibility
Local SEO is a game-changer for tow truck services. Most customers search for towing companies in their vicinity, making it essential to optimize your online presence for local searches. This includes setting up your Google My Business profile and ensuring your website is optimized for local keywords.
Additionally, encourage customers to leave reviews on platforms like Google and Yelp, as positive reviews can significantly impact your local rankings. Utilize local keywords in your website content, meta descriptions, and blog posts to boost visibility in search results. This approach not only helps your business rank better but also builds credibility with potential customers.
By focusing on local SEO, you’ll ensure that your towing services appear prominently when potential customers search for help in your area, making it a vital part of your marketing plan.

Effective Advertising Strategies for Towing Services
Advertising is crucial for driving new business. Consider a mix of traditional and digital advertising methods. Local newspapers, radio spots, and community bulletin boards can still be effective, especially for reaching older demographics. However, digital advertising is where the real magic happens. Use Google Ads to target specific keywords related to towing services and promote your business on social media platforms like Facebook and Instagram. Create engaging ads that showcase your services and offer promotions or discounts.
For instance, a well-timed Facebook ad campaign during the winter months can attract customers needing emergency towing due to bad weather. By creating ads that address seasonal needs, you can ensure that your towing service remains relevant and top-of-mind for potential clients. This strategic approach can lead to higher engagement and conversion rates.
By combining traditional and digital advertising methods, you can reach a broader audience and ensure your towing service stays top-of-mind for potential customers. A diverse advertising strategy will help you maximize your reach and effectiveness in attracting new clients.

Engaging with Customers on Social Media
Social media platforms are invaluable for building relationships with your customers. They provide a space for you to engage with your audience, showcase your services, and share valuable content. Platforms like Facebook and Instagram can be particularly effective for visual storytelling. By sharing photos of your tow trucks in action, customer testimonials, and behind-the-scenes content, you can humanize your brand and create a deeper connection with your audience.
Consider running contests or promotions that encourage user-generated content, which can enhance engagement and attract new followers. For example, ask customers to share their experiences with your towing service and tag your business for a chance to win a discount or free service. This not only boosts your visibility but also fosters a sense of community around your brand.
By actively engaging with your audience on social media, you create a community around your brand that fosters loyalty and encourages repeat business. It’s an effective way to keep your towing service at the forefront of potential customers’ minds.

Measuring Your Marketing Success
It’s vital to measure the success of your marketing efforts to understand what works and what doesn’t. Utilize tools like Google Analytics to track website traffic, conversion rates, and customer engagement metrics. These insights allow you to assess the effectiveness of your advertising strategies and make necessary adjustments.
Additionally, monitor your social media analytics to gauge which posts perform best and adjust your strategy accordingly. For instance, if a particular type of content generates high engagement, consider producing more of it. Regularly assess your advertising campaigns to determine ROI and refine your approach based on data-driven insights.
By continuously measuring and analyzing your marketing efforts, you can make informed decisions that enhance your tow truck marketing plan and drive better results. This proactive approach ensures that your marketing strategies evolve with the changing landscape and customer preferences.

Adapting Your Marketing Plan Seasonally
Seasonal changes can significantly impact your towing business. Adapting your marketing plan to align with seasonal trends ensures you remain relevant and attract customers year-round. For example, winter months may see an increase in demand for towing services due to snow and ice, making it crucial to tailor your marketing efforts accordingly.
Create targeted promotions or content based on seasonal needs. For instance, offering winter readiness tips or discounts for emergency towing services during peak winter months can draw in customers who need assistance. This proactive approach not only meets customer needs but also positions your business as a reliable resource during critical times.
By staying proactive and adjusting your marketing strategies with the seasons, you can capitalize on increased demand and maintain a steady flow of business. This adaptability is key to sustaining growth in the competitive towing industry.

Building Customer Loyalty
Retaining customers is often more cost-effective than acquiring new ones. Building a loyalty program can encourage repeat business and foster long-term relationships. Consider offering discounts or rewards for frequent users of your towing services. This not only incentivizes customers to return but also makes them feel valued.
Additionally, follow up with customers post-service to gather feedback and express appreciation. This not only helps improve your service but also shows customers that you value their business. A simple thank you email or a request for a review can go a long way in enhancing customer satisfaction and loyalty.
By focusing on customer loyalty, you create a stable revenue stream and establish a positive reputation within your community. Loyal customers are more likely to recommend your towing service to others, amplifying your marketing efforts through word-of-mouth.

Innovating Your Marketing Approach
The towing industry is constantly evolving, and so should your marketing strategies. Stay ahead of the curve by exploring innovative marketing techniques such as using video content to showcase your services or creating engaging blog posts about towing tips and tricks. This not only informs potential customers but also establishes your expertise in the field.
Additionally, consider collaborating with local businesses or influencers to broaden your reach. These partnerships can create mutually beneficial relationships that enhance visibility and credibility in your community. For instance, teaming up with a local auto repair shop can provide cross-promotional opportunities that attract new customers.
By embracing innovation and adapting your marketing approach, you’ll ensure that your tow truck marketing plan remains effective and relevant in a competitive market. Staying updated on industry trends and customer preferences will give you a significant advantage.
